Upgrade your existing HVAC system with a hybrid dual-fuel heat pump and dramatically cut gas consumption and CO₂ emissions. The intelli-HEAT system features two integrated components: an outdoor heat pump that replaces your current AC condenser and an indoor unit that installs directly onto your existing gas furnace*. This intelligent setup boosts cooling efficiency during hot weather and automatically selects the most efficient heating source—gas or electricity—when temperatures drop. The result: consistently optimized performance, lower energy costs, and superior comfort year-round.
The multi-position air handler delivers best-in-class construction with a rugged black ZAM finish, 1″ R4.2 insulation, and exceptionally low cabinet air leakage. Its high-efficiency EC motor offers three selectable static pressure settings for precise airflow control, with optional electric heat kits available for added versatility. Designed for seamless integration, the unit includes built-in controls for a humidifier, ERV, and auxiliary heat. This air handler is an excellent solution for replacing traditional forced-air systems or serving new home additions with efficient, dependable comfort.

Offered in both single-zone and multi-zone configurations, these low-static units are designed to efficiently heat and cool one or two rooms using short duct runs. They can be installed discreetly in an attic, above a ceiling, below the floor, or hidden behind a bulkhead, delivering powerful comfort without sacrificing interior aesthetics.
The mid-static horizontal ducted indoor unit delivers flexible capacity options, from low outputs ideal for Passive House applications to higher capacities suited for light commercial spaces like offices, retail shops, and restaurants. Designed to serve large areas or multiple rooms, these units install discreetly in attics, above ceilings, below floors, or behind bulkheads, providing powerful performance with a clean, hidden appearance.
